news 2026/4/16 11:15:53

完整示例:电脑USB端口故障检测全过程

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
完整示例:电脑USB端口故障检测全过程

电脑USB端口失灵?从驱动到焊点,一文讲透全链路排查实战

你有没有遇到过这样的情况:
U盘插上去没反应、手机连电脑充不了电、键盘鼠标突然罢工……明明设备在别的电脑上好好的,怎么到了这台就“无法识别”?

别急着换主板或重装系统。90%的USB故障其实有迹可循——问题可能出在你根本没想到的地方:也许是BIOS里一个被关闭的小开关,也许是电源管理偷偷把端口“休眠”了,又或者只是某个焊点虚接导致供电不稳。

作为一名常年和硬件打交道的嵌入式工程师,我见过太多人因为一次误判而花冤枉钱返修。今天,我就带你从软件层一路挖到物理层,用真实排查逻辑还原一次完整的USB故障诊断全过程。无论你是普通用户还是IT运维,都能照着做,快速定位问题根源。


先别拆机!先看这三个地方

很多人一发现USB没反应,第一反应就是拔插、重启、换线。这些操作确实有用,但如果你希望真正解决问题而不是碰运气,就得建立一套系统化的排查流程

我们遵循的原则是:由软到硬、由外到内、由通用到专用

也就是说:
- 先查操作系统层面是否正常;
- 再确认BIOS底层有没有禁用;
- 最后才动手测量电压、检查焊点。

这样既能避免误判,又能节省时间。


第一步:用设备管理器锁定异常线索

Windows 的「设备管理器」是你第一个该打开的工具。它就像一台电脑的“体检报告”,能告诉你哪些硬件出了问题。

怎么看?

右键“此电脑” → “管理” → “设备管理器”,展开“通用串行总线控制器”这一项。

你会看到一堆名字带 USB 的条目,比如:
-USB Root Hub
-xHCI Compliant Host Controller
-USB Mass Storage Device

重点观察两点:

  1. 有没有黄色感叹号(!)或红色叉号(×)?
    - 有 → 驱动或配置出问题
    - 没有 → 至少系统层面识别到了控制器

  2. 插入设备时是否有新条目出现?
    - 插入U盘后,应该短暂出现“未知设备”或“USB大容量存储设备”
    - 如果完全没动静 → 可能是硬件级失效

✅ 实战技巧:有时候系统会把U盘识别成“Unknown Device”,这时候不要慌。右键 → 更新驱动程序 → 自动搜索,往往就能解决。

更进一步:用 PowerShell 快速筛查

手动翻设备管理器太慢?写一行脚本批量查看所有USB相关设备状态:

Get-WmiObject -Class Win32_PnPEntity | Where-Object { $_.Name -match "USB" } | Select-Object Name, Status, ConfigManagerErrorCode, DeviceID

运行结果中关注两个字段:
-Status应为 “OK”
-ConfigManagerErrorCode必须为0

常见错误码含义:
| 错误码 | 含义 |
|--------|------|
| 10 | 设备无法启动(可能是驱动损坏) |
| 28 | 驱动未安装 |
| 45 | 当前未连接设备(但控制器存在) |
| 43 | 设备报告自身故障 |

如果多个USB控制器都报错 Code 10,那很可能不是个别设备的问题,而是整个USB子系统出了状况。


第二步:进 BIOS 看看“开关”开了没

就算操作系统再强大,也得靠BIOS先把硬件“点亮”。如果BIOS里把USB控制器关了,那你插再多设备也是白搭。

哪些设置最关键?

不同主板界面略有差异,但核心选项基本一致:

设置项功能说明推荐状态
XHCI Pre-Boot Mode是否启用USB 3.0支持(蓝色接口)✔️ 开启
EHCI Hand-off允许系统接管USB 2.0控制器✔️ 开启
Legacy USB Support支持老式键盘鼠标在DOS环境使用✔️ 开启(除非特殊需求)
USB Port Disable单独关闭某物理端口❌ 关闭(除非故意禁用)

⚠️ 特别提醒:有些品牌机(尤其是联想、戴尔商用本)默认关闭XHCI模式以提升兼容性,结果导致USB 3.0设备无法识别。务必手动开启!

如何验证?

进入BIOS后做个小测试:
1. 插入一个已知正常的U盘(最好是USB 3.0)
2. 观察是否能在启动画面看到盘符提示(如“Press F12 to select boot device”时列出U盘)
3. 若看不到 → 极可能是XHCI未启用

此外,CMOS电池没电也会导致BIOS设置重置。如果你的电脑经常“忘记日期时间”,也要怀疑这一点。


第三步:到底是哪个环节断了?

现在我们来梳理一下USB从插入到识别的完整链条:

[外部设备] ↓ 插入 [USB端口引脚] ↓ 电信号传输 [主板供电电路 → 提供5V] ↓ 数据通道 [USB控制器芯片(集成于南桥/PCH)] ↓ 控制信号 [BIOS初始化 → 操作系统加载驱动] ↓ 软件响应 [Windows设备管理器显示设备]

任何一个环节断裂,都会导致最终“无法识别”。

所以我们要问自己几个关键问题:

  • 所有USB口都不行?→ 很可能是控制器或BIOS问题
  • 只有一个口不行?→ 可能是局部损坏
  • 插某些设备可以,某些不行?→ 可能是供电不足或协议兼容问题

第四步:动手测电压!这才是硬核排查

当软件手段无效时,就必须动真格的了——拿万用表上。

标准USB Type-A接口引脚定义

引脚名称功能
1VCC+5V电源输出
2D-数据负线
3D+数据正线
4GND接地
测试方法(安全第一!)
  1. 断电测通断(防短路)
    - 使用万用表蜂鸣档,测试VCC与GND之间是否短路
    - 正常应无蜂鸣声;若有 → 主板可能存在短路风险

  2. 通电测电压(关键步骤)
    - 开机状态下,红表笔接VCC(第1脚),黑表笔接GND(第4脚)
    - 正常值应在4.75V ~ 5.25V之间
    - 若低于4.5V → 供电能力不足,可能导致高功耗设备无法工作

  3. 动态负载测试
    - 接入移动硬盘等大功率设备,再次测量电压
    - 跌幅超过0.5V即视为不合格
    - 常见原因:保险电阻老化、电源管理IC性能下降

🔧 工具建议:
- 数字万用表(推荐Fluke、优利德)
- USB电流电压监测仪(淘宝十几块钱一个,可实时查看压降)
- 示波器(进阶玩家可用来看D+/D-差分信号波形)

典型故障对应现象
故障表现可能原因
所有端口无5V输出南桥供电模块故障、主保险丝熔断
某一口单独无电局部PTC自恢复保险损坏、排针接触不良
间歇性断连焊点虚焊、PCB微裂纹、热胀冷缩影响
插低功耗设备正常,高功耗失败电源芯片带载能力下降

常见坑点与避坑秘籍

❌ 坑1:以为重启能解决一切

很多用户反复插拔、重启,却忽略了“电源管理节能策略”这个隐形杀手。

解决方案
- 设备管理器中找到每个USB Root Hub
- 右键 → 属性 → 电源管理
-取消勾选“允许计算机关闭此设备以节约电源”

否则,系统可能在你长时间不用USB时自动切断供电,造成“假死”现象。

❌ 坑2:线材质量被忽视

一根劣质数据线足以让你怀疑人生。特别是Type-C线,市面上大量非标线材只做了VCC/GND连通,根本没有接D+/D-,只能充电不能传数据。

建议
- 使用带E-Marker芯片的认证线材(尤其用于高速传输或PD快充)
- 对重要设备(如移动SSD)使用带独立供电的USB HUB

❌ 坑3:误判为硬件损坏

曾有一位同事拿着笔记本说“USB坏了”,结果我发现是他把U盘插进了仅支持关机充电的USB口(通常标有闪电符号)。这种接口在系统运行时是禁用的!

提醒:部分笔记本设有“Sleep and Charge”功能,这类端口在关机后仍可供电,但开机后反而不可用作数据传输。


工程师视角的设计启示

作为开发者或维护人员,了解这些问题背后的设计逻辑,才能更好地预防和修复。

优秀设计应有的特性

  1. 独立限流保护
    每个USB端口应配有PTC自恢复保险丝,防止单个设备短路拖垮整组供电。

  2. 信号完整性保障
    高速信号线(D+/D-)需等长走线、远离干扰源,避免串扰影响稳定性。

  3. 散热考虑
    多个高功耗设备同时使用时,主控芯片温升明显,合理布局散热孔很重要。

  4. 充分兼容性测试
    出厂前应对主流设备(U盘、摄像头、蓝牙适配器、指纹仪)进行交叉测试。


最后的忠告:别让简单问题变复杂

面对“电脑无法识别usb设备”,最怕两种极端:
- 一种是盲目重装系统,浪费半天时间;
- 一种是直接送修换主板,花了几千块才发现只是BIOS设置错了。

记住这个排查顺序:

  1. 换设备试试→ 排除是不是U盘/线的问题
  2. 看设备管理器→ 查有没有黄叹号
  3. 进BIOS检查设置→ XHCI开了吗?
  4. 测电压→ 有5V吗?带载稳吗?
  5. 考虑维修→ 到这一步再谈换主板也不迟

当你下次再遇到USB失灵,不妨静下心来,按这条路径一步步走一遍。你会发现,很多看似玄学的问题,其实都有清晰的答案。

毕竟,真正的技术不是知道多少术语,而是能在混乱中理出秩序,在无声中听见信号

如果你在实践中遇到了特别棘手的情况,欢迎留言讨论——我们一起把它“修”明白。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/15 8:56:20

3步极速搭建:Docker容器化部署Obsidian个人知识库

3步极速搭建:Docker容器化部署Obsidian个人知识库 【免费下载链接】awesome-obsidian 🕶️ Awesome stuff for Obsidian 项目地址: https://gitcode.com/gh_mirrors/aw/awesome-obsidian 你是否曾因笔记软件的环境配置而耗费数小时?当…

作者头像 李华
网站建设 2026/4/14 15:56:08

破解学术知识管理的3大核心难题:Zotero智能解决方案深度解析

破解学术知识管理的3大核心难题:Zotero智能解决方案深度解析 【免费下载链接】zotero Zotero is a free, easy-to-use tool to help you collect, organize, annotate, cite, and share your research sources. 项目地址: https://gitcode.com/gh_mirrors/zo/zote…

作者头像 李华
网站建设 2026/4/13 14:56:20

终极游戏自动化助手:告别重复劳动,拥抱智能游戏新时代

终极游戏自动化助手:告别重复劳动,拥抱智能游戏新时代 【免费下载链接】ok-wuthering-waves 鸣潮 后台自动战斗 自动刷声骸上锁合成 自动肉鸽 Automation for Wuthering Waves 项目地址: https://gitcode.com/GitHub_Trending/ok/ok-wuthering-waves …

作者头像 李华
网站建设 2026/4/13 8:11:07

AI智能证件照制作工坊是否免费?开源可部署版本使用教程

AI智能证件照制作工坊是否免费?开源可部署版本使用教程 1. 引言 1.1 项目背景与需求痛点 在日常生活中,证件照是办理身份证、护照、签证、考试报名、简历投递等场景的刚需。传统方式依赖照相馆拍摄,流程繁琐、成本高,且难以保证…

作者头像 李华
网站建设 2026/4/15 2:17:05

基于Java+SpringBoot+SSM高校学生绩点管理系统(源码+LW+调试文档+讲解等)/高校学生成绩管理系统/大学生绩点管理平台/校园绩点管理系统/学生绩点查询系统/高校GPA管理系统

博主介绍 💗博主介绍:✌全栈领域优质创作者,专注于Java、小程序、Python技术领域和计算机毕业项目实战✌💗 👇🏻 精彩专栏 推荐订阅👇🏻 2025-2026年最新1000个热门Java毕业设计选题…

作者头像 李华
网站建设 2026/4/12 19:16:31

ESP32 SPI通信配置:Arduino实战项目详解

ESP32 SPI通信实战:从零搭建稳定高效的Arduino项目一个常见的开发痛点你有没有遇到过这样的情况?手头的ESP32连接了一个SPI传感器,代码烧录成功、接线反复检查无误,但串口始终输出0xFF或0x00——数据像是“死”了一样。或者&#…

作者头像 李华